Summary
Bibliographic description
[18],14;31,[1]; 194,197-215,[21];[2],221-227,[3]; [8],64p.,[2] plates . port.. . fol. The portrait and engraved titlepage are excised and pasted onto the front flyleaves. Provenance: Booklabel: Henry Massingberd, Gunby. 1781. No. 73 [i.e. Henry Massingberd (d.1784)]. Binding: Seventeenth-century full mottled calf; sewn onto five raised supports; spine gilt; red spine label: Bacons Natural History.
